3D rendered images of mitochondria in living HeLa cells with 3DSIM for single-photon activation
Description
The 3D rendered images of mitochondria visualized by Skylan-NS in living HeLa cells were captured with three-dimensional structured illumination microscopy (3DSIM) using single-photon activation. The distribution of mitochondria by the background in 3DSIM was obscured. Skylan-NS is a photoswitchable green fluorescent protein. CW laser is used for single-photon activation, which is more efficient and allows measurement with higher temporal resolution.
